March 29, 2021 – The Independent Commission of Investigations (INDECOM) mourns the loss of our colleague and friend, Director of Complaints, Mr. Nigel Morgan, who died this morning following complications with COVID-19.

Mr. Morgan joined INDECOM in 2011, as the Commission’s first Director of Complaints and his passing is a huge loss for his family, friends and colleagues.

Commissioner of INDECOM, Hugh Faulkner expressed that “Nigel interacted with everyone in all walks of life, earning deserved recognition as a revered and trusted friend to many.  He served INDECOM fervently and will be an irreplaceable broker of peace and consensus; that will be the legacy that he leaves. His sense of humour and love of life and entertaining, made him a joy to work with.  He will be truly missed.”

The Commission acknowledges the messages of condolences and sympathies, for which we are grateful, as we all try to cope during this very difficult time.
